This is a 3117 square foot, single family home. This home is located at 174 Shadowcreek Trl, Dubberly, LA 71024.
Off market
Zestimate®
$515,200
174 Shadowcreek Trl, Dubberly, LA 71024
--beds
--baths
3,117sqft
SingleFamily
Built in 2020
4 Acres Lot
$515,200 Zestimate®
$165/sqft
$2,072 Estimated rent